Relative Genetics is a business unit of Sorenson Genomics LLC . The
Sorenson Genomics LLC laboratory is ISO (International Standards
Organization) 17025 certified for all genetic genealogical testing services
by the Forensic Quality Services of the National Forensic Science and
Technology Center (NFSTC). The scope of the ISO 17025 certification includes
all genetic genealogical services and test methodologies. ISO certification
internally helps to ensure the repeatability of the laboratory's processes.
An internally stated quality commitment is an important first step for a
publicly accessible diagnostic laboratory followed by seeing the need for
external validation services that further guarantees on-going quality to a
laboratory's customer set. The Sorenson Genomics LLC laboratory utilizes
the external accreditation services of both the American Association of
Blood Banks (AABB) and the Forensic Quality Services of the National
Forensic Science and Technology Center (NFSTC) to validate their on-going
quality.
Lastly, Sorenson Genomics LLC Laboratory / Relative Genetics uses Standard
Reference Material (SRM) from the National Institutes of Standards and
Technology (NIST) in their DNA marker analysis which provides for
traceability and allows them to meet the proficiency and traceability
requirements of their external accreditation agencies (AABB and NFSTC).
